Aucterra MCP Server
This repository configures an MCP-compatible server for Aucterra's Document Understanding APIs using the aucterra-mcp package.
It enables LLM agents to interact with Aucterra's document classification, extraction, etc. services using Google's Agent Development Kit (ADK).

⚙️ Tool Behavior
This MCP tool provides structured access to Aucterra's:
📁 Document Classification
🗂️ Key-Value Field Extraction (Simple + List fields)
The tool accepts pdf or image files and returns structured JSON output.
